Format: |
DIRECTORY | [DLaufwerk][,UGerät][,Dateiname] |
|
Zweck: | Zeigt das Verzeichnis der Diskette auf dem
spezifizierten Laufwerk oder Teile davon auf dem Bildschirm an (s.a.
Kapitel 6.5).
Laufwerk
Ganzzahliger Wert von 0 oder 1. Voreingestellt ist hier der Wert 0.
Gerät
Ein ganzzahliger Wert zwischen 4 und 30, der die
Geräteadresse der Floppy-Disk angibt. Voreingestellt ist hier
der Wert 8.
Dateiname
Wahlweise ein Dateiname als Zeichenkettenkonstante in
Anführungsstrichen ("), für den der
Verzeichniseintrag angezeigt werden soll. Um Dateien mit gleichen
Namensteilen anzuzeigen, dürfen die Jokerzeichen * und ? (s.a.
Kapitel 6.3) verwendet werden.
|
Bemerkungen: | Die Anzeige langer
Verzeichnisse führt zum Aufrollen des Bildschirms. Mit Hilfe
der NO SCROLL-Taste (s. Kapitel 5.2) kann die Anzeige angehalten
werden, mit der C= (Commodore)-Taste kann sie verlangsamt werden.
Werden
für die Parameter Laufwerk,
Gerät
und/oder Dateiname Variablen
verwendet, so müssen diese in Klammern gesetzt werden.
Der
DIRECTORY-Befehl ist mit dem CATALOG-Befehl
(s. dort) identisch.
|
Beispiele: | DIRECTORY
Alle
Verzeichniseinträge von der Diskette in Laufwerk 0 der
Floppy-Disk mit der Geräteadresse 8 werden angezeigt.
DIRECTORY
D1,U9,"DATEN"
Der Verzeichniseintrag
der Datei "DATEN" auf der Diskette in Laufwerk 1 der Floppy-Disk mit
der Geräteadresse 9 wird, falls vorhanden, angezeigt.
DIRECTORY
"AB*"
Die Verzeichniseinträge
für alle Dateien, deren Namen mit AB beginnen, auf der
Diskette in Laufwerk 0 der Floppy-Disk mit der Geräteadresse 8
werden angezeigt.
DIRECTORY
"DATEI???.ARB"
Die
Verzeichniseinträge für alle Dateien, deren Namen
zwischen den Zeichen DATEI und .ARB drei beliebige Zeichen enthalten,
auf der Diskette in Laufwerk 0 der Floppy-Disk mit der
Geräteadresse 8 werden angezeigt.
|
Achtung: Um ein
Diskettenverzeichnis z.B. von Laufwerk 0 auf der Floppy-Disk mit der
Geräteadresse 8 auf dem Drucker mit der Geräteadresse
4 auszugeben, muß folgende Anweisungssequenz im Direktmodus
eingegeben werden: |
| LOAD"$0",8 OPEN4,4:CMD4:LIST PRINT#4:CLOSE4 |